Abstract

The invention discloses a kind of wetland Rotary tillage blades, including helical blade and the Rotary tillage blade for being fixed on helical blade end, are provided with helical blade on the blade, can effectively avoid rotary cultivator and get deeply stuck in farming marshy land, deep paddy field.

Background technique
In the prior art, mechanization of agriculture production is mainly ploughing to the tillage method of soil, rake is ploughed and rotary tillage, ploughing master If drawing ploughshare using traction mechanism to overturn soil and achieve the purpose that farming, rake, which is ploughed, mainly passes through dragger Structure draws the tools such as disc harrow, spike-tooth harrow or paddy field star-toothed harrows and carries out surface cultivation to soil, usually to soil after ploughing The smooth intensive cultivation fine crushing that ground carries out is turned into industry.Rotary tillage mainly cuts soil using the rotation of cutter to complete Related operation, in mountainous region and knob, generallys use miniature gasoline engine or small diesel engine is the cultivated formula of hand steered step of power The mechanical series of agricultural tillage, this typically no dedicated traction mechanism of small-size rotary tiller, when work are the rotations using rotary blade Transfer to for tractive force realize move ahead, this rotary blade is usually transversely mounted along rotary cultivator, and the blade on rotary blade is set to vertical Directly in the plane of cutter disk axis, the reaction masterpiece generated perpendicular to capstan head axial direction is acted on soil when rotary blade rotates For the tractive force that rotary cultivator advances, however usually there is following two in the rotary blade of this structure type, one is due to Rotary knife axis is mutually perpendicular to rotary cultivator direction of advance so that rotary blade during advance be easy winding field weeds and Sundries needs artificially to cut off and remove twining grass, causes operating personnel's labor when twining careless quantity excessively influences rotary blade normal work Fatigue resistance is big, while reducing soil cultivation efficiency.The second is existing rotary blade this reaction force of farming marshy land relatively When small soil, the reaction force that rotary blade generates is so small that will to generate when enough dragger devices do not move ahead and get deeply stuck in, once occurring It gets deeply stuck in and has nothing for it in addition to manually suing and labouring, and small part is equipped with the rotary cultivator of the traction mechanisms such as traction wheel, the axis of rotary blade Horizontally disposed along direction of advance, traction wheel is also easily trapped into rotten ground or deep paddy field, since its rotary blade can not be rotary cultivator Upward liter lifting force is provided, therefore, when traction wheel is got deeply stuck in, can only also rely on and manually sue and labour.
Therefore, in order to solve the above problem, a kind of wetland Rotary tillage blade is needed, helical blade is provided on the blade, can have Effect avoids rotary cultivator from getting deeply stuck in farming marshy land, deep paddy field.

Specific embodiment
Fig. 1 is the structural diagram of the present invention, as shown, the wetland Rotary tillage blade 3 of the present embodiment, including helical blade 2 and it is fixed on the Rotary tillage blade 3 of 2 end of helical blade;Helical blade 2 can generate the propulsion along tubular tool apron axial direction when rotating Power, which can assist to drive rotary cultivator to advance together, to effectively avoid rotary cultivator in farming marshy land or deep paddy field It gets deeply stuck in, 2 one end of helical blade of the present embodiment is fixed with Rotary tillage blade 3, and the other end extends concordant as end surface of knife holder;This Rotary tillage blade is solderable to be connected on tubular tool apron 1, Rotary tillage blade 3 can integral type forming or be welded in 2 front end of helical blade, rear end or Both ends, this setup can simplify the structure of rotary blade, shorten cutter axial dimension.
In the present embodiment, the blade of the Rotary tillage blade 3 is arcuate blade, and therefore, Rotary tillage blade 3 enters when working from root Soil, enters soil in a manner of sliding cutting and process impact of burying is smaller, guarantees that the cutting resistance of burying of Rotary tillage blade 3 is smaller, rotary tillage This sliding cutting formula of blade 3 is buried the mode of farming hard place, compared with the existing rotary tillage power blader formula of hitting is buried, the rotary blade of the present embodiment After 3 embedded depth of piece reaches design requirement, hardly there is jumping phenomena in rotary cultivator, and then solves traditional rotary cultivator and ploughing Make to vibrate big, tilth shakiness when hard place, operation difficulty is big, is easy the problems such as out of control and dangerous, whole in the present embodiment A Rotary tillage blade 3 is cambered blade, and one end of the fixed Rotary tillage blade of helical blade 2 is also identical with cambered blade radius of curvature Arc, convenient for making Rotary tillage blade 3 match and be welded and fixed with 2 end of helical blade.
In the present embodiment, the range of the radius of curvature r of the blade of the Rotary tillage blade is 100mm < r <
300mm;In the present embodiment, which is preferably 115mm, and the radius of curvature of blade in the range can Utmostly reduce Rotary tillage blade 3 to bury the resistance of cutting, meanwhile, improve the cultivating quality of soil.
In the present embodiment, the length of the helical blade 2 is a screw pitch or multiple screw pitch, according to the volume of rotary cultivator with And need the soil hardness of farming, determine the length of helical blade 2, when need farming soil it is softer when, Ying Caiyong screw pitch number More helical blade 2, and then increase the axial thrust generated when helical blade 2 and soil effect.
In the present embodiment, the helical blade 2 also may be less than the sector of a screw pitch;When the soil of rotary cultivator farming Earth hardness is moderate, and the sector less than a screw pitch can be used, to reduce the volume of cutter, improves the compact of rotary cultivator Property.
In the present embodiment, the width of the helical blade 2 is less than the length of Rotary tillage blade 3, therefore, outside Rotary tillage blade 3 End is higher than 2 outer of helical blade, improves the depth of soil that rotary blade can reach, guarantees the tilth of soil, to meet The planting requirement of crop.
In the present embodiment, the Rotary tillage blade 3 is by welding or is shaped in 2 end of helical blade, it is ensured that rotary tillage The bonding strength of blade 3 and helical blade 2 avoids Rotary tillage blade 3 from fractureing in soil cultivation.
